💰 #ArbitrageTradingStrategy is a classic approach in crypto that takes advantage of price differences across markets. Simply put, traders buy an asset on one exchange where the price is lower and simultaneously sell it on another where the price is higher, locking in a risk-free (or low-risk) profit.
Crypto markets, being highly fragmented and fast-moving, often create these opportunities — whether across different exchanges or even within pairs (like BTC/USDT vs BTC/ETH). Automated bots often scan for arbitrage chances, but savvy traders can spot manual opportunities too.
However, successful arbitrage requires speed, low fees, and enough liquidity. Delays, withdrawal limits, or sudden price moves can turn a sure profit into a loss. Always calculate net gains after fees and spreads.
